Red crystals of cis-dioxo(3-methoxysalicylaldehyde 4-methylthiosemicarbazonato-N, O, S)(γ -picoline-N)molybdenum(VI), [MoO2L(γ -pic)], [L2– = CH3OC6H4(O)CH=NN=C(S)NHCH3, 3-methoxysalicylaldehyde 4-methylthiosemicarbazonato] were prepared by the reaction of [MoO2L]n with γ -picoline in dry methanol. The title compound crystallized in the monoclinic space group P21/n, a = 6.7984(7) Å , b = 15.9760(12) Å , c = 17.1466(14) Å , β = 93.613(8)°, V = 1858.6(3) Å 3, Z = 4. The coordination geometry around the molybdenum center is distorted octahedral with the tridentate thiosemicarbazonato ligand (L2– ) bonded meridionally to the [MoO2]2+ core. The sixth coordination site is occupied by a weakly bound γ -picoline molecule. The adjacent molecules are joined by the N– H· · · O hydrogen bonds between their amino and methoxy groups thus forming infinite molecular chains. The three-dimensional solid-state structure is achieved by the additional C– H· · · O, C– H· · · π and van der Waals interactions.
